**Postmortem timeline — 09:17**

At 09:17 the Quickfind autocomplete index hit 4s p99. Cause: nightly rebuild on Perchline left the index unmerged, so queries fanned out across 600 segments. Mitigation: forced merge at 09:41, latency recovered by 09:55. Contractor note: always verify segment count post-rebuild. The affected index build is identified by the token below.

pipeline stamp: htk4_ae36

## Local Setup

The Murkwell cache layer places a bloom filter in front of the Pellstone key-value store to avoid pointless disk reads on missing keys. For local work, run `murkwell dev --seed` to populate the filter from the sample keyset; expect roughly a 1% false-positive rate with default sizing. If the filter and store drift out of sync, rebuild with `murkwell rebuild-filter` before debugging anything else. The rebuild job reads key metadata from the catalog database, so point it at the following connection.

replica DSN, kajep-yahag: mssql://praok_svc:iF@db-8d68.plorvaio.local:5432/eliion

## Deployment

The Lumacache image service has a known slow leak in its thumbnail cache layer: evicted entries keep a reference alive through the decoder pool, so resident memory creeps up roughly 40 MB per hour under steady load. Until the refactor in the Harkness branch lands, we mitigate by capping pool size and scheduling a rolling restart every 12 hours. Deploy with the supervisor, never bare, or the restart hook won't fire. The deployment relies on the configuration values listed below.

settings of bagug-tahof:
holath:
  pin: 7837
  metrics_host: metrics.holath.tolvaqsys.internal
  tenant: quenath
  seal: seal_6001b3af